{"id":"417b8136-2d10-45b6-b013-7fab759d9dd4","shortId":"SdYz5f","kind":"skill","title":"html-ppt-zhangzara-signal","tagline":"Signal — Deep navy canvas with bone paper and a single muted-gold accent; institutional with quiet weight. Anything that should feel weighty, considered, and credibly institutional: investor decks, board presentations, consulting deliverables, legal / policy briefs, advisory pitc","description":"# Signal\n\n> Deep navy canvas with bone paper and a single muted-gold accent; institutional with quiet weight.\n\nA single self-contained HTML deck — typography, palette, decorative system,\nand slide vocabulary are all tuned together. Mixing layouts across templates\nbreaks the system; stay inside this one.\n\n## At a glance\n\n- **Scheme:** mixed\n- **Formality:** high\n- **Density:** high\n- **Slides in demo:** 18\n\n## Best for\n\nAnything that should feel weighty, considered, and credibly institutional: investor decks, board presentations, consulting deliverables, legal / policy briefs, advisory pitches. Also a strong choice for tech, research, or brand work that wants to read as quietly authoritative rather than loud.\n\n## Avoid for\n\nContexts that should feel hot, fast, or intentionally playful — the navy + gold restraint commits to a sober voice.\n\n## Workflow\n\n1. **Clone `example.html`** into the user's workspace as the working file.\n2. **Replace placeholder content** with the user's real headlines, body copy,\n   numbers, names, dates, and section labels. Match existing dimensions when\n   swapping image placeholders.\n3. **Preserve the design system.** Never substitute fonts, recolor the palette,\n   restructure the layout grid, or strip decorative elements (corner brackets,\n   paper grain, geometric shapes, illustrated SVGs). They are part of the\n   identity.\n4. **Adjust deck length by duplicating layouts.** If the user has more content\n   than the demo holds, duplicate an existing slide of the most appropriate\n   layout. If less, drop slides from the bottom. Update page-number labels.\n5. **Designing missing layouts:** if a slide needs a layout the template\n   doesn't have, design it from scratch using the same fonts, palette,\n   decorative vocabulary, spacing rhythm, and component grammar — never bail\n   to a different template.\n6. **Keep the navigation runtime as shipped.** If the deck ships an\n   `assets/deck-stage.js` or inline keyboard handler, leave it intact.\n\n## Output contract\n\nEmit between `<artifact>` tags:\n\n```\n<artifact identifier=\"zhangzara-signal\" type=\"text/html\" title=\"Deck Title\">\n<!doctype html>\n<html>...</html>\n</artifact>\n```\n\n## Source & license\n\nVendored from upstream MIT-licensed\n[`zarazhangrui/beautiful-html-templates`](https://github.com/zarazhangrui/beautiful-html-templates/tree/main/templates/signal).\n\nThe full upstream MIT license text — including the original copyright notice — ships in this skill at\n[`LICENSE`](./LICENSE) and must be redistributed alongside any copy of `example.html`,\n`template.json`, or any vendored `assets/` runtime. See `template.json` for the upstream metadata snapshot.","tags":["html","ppt","zhangzara","signal","open","design","nexu-io","agent-skills","ai-agents","ai-design","byok","claude"],"capabilities":["skill","source-nexu-io","skill-html-ppt-zhangzara-signal","topic-agent-skills","topic-ai-agents","topic-ai-design","topic-byok","topic-claude","topic-claude-code-for-design","topic-claude-design","topic-coding-agents","topic-design-systems","topic-design-tools","topic-desktop-app","topic-figma-alternative"],"categories":["open-design"],"synonyms":[],"warnings":[],"endpointUrl":"https://skills.sh/nexu-io/open-design/html-ppt-zhangzara-signal","protocol":"skill","transport":"skills-sh","auth":{"type":"none","details":{"cli":"npx skills add nexu-io/open-design","source_repo":"https://github.com/nexu-io/open-design","install_from":"skills.sh"}},"qualityScore":"0.700","qualityRationale":"deterministic score 0.70 from registry signals: · indexed on github topic:agent-skills · 36607 github stars · SKILL.md body (2,657 chars)","verified":false,"liveness":"unknown","lastLivenessCheck":null,"agentReviews":{"count":0,"score_avg":null,"cost_usd_avg":null,"success_rate":null,"latency_p50_ms":null,"narrative_summary":null,"summary_updated_at":null},"enrichmentModel":"deterministic:skill-github:v1","enrichmentVersion":1,"enrichedAt":"2026-05-11T06:52:23.943Z","embedding":null,"createdAt":"2026-05-08T06:51:50.594Z","updatedAt":"2026-05-11T06:52:23.943Z","lastSeenAt":"2026-05-11T06:52:23.943Z","tsv":"'/license':366 '/zarazhangrui/beautiful-html-templates/tree/main/templates/signal).':348 '1':167 '18':103 '2':179 '3':204 '4':237 '5':275 '6':312 'accent':19,57 'across':82 'adjust':238 'advisori':42,124 'alongsid':371 'also':126 'anyth':24,106 'appropri':261 'asset':380 'assets/deck-stage.js':324 'authorit':142 'avoid':146 'bail':307 'best':104 'board':35,117 'bodi':189 'bone':11,49 'bottom':269 'bracket':224 'brand':134 'break':84 'brief':41,123 'canva':9,47 'choic':129 'clone':168 'commit':161 'compon':304 'consid':29,111 'consult':37,119 'contain':66 'content':182,249 'context':148 'contract':333 'copi':190,373 'copyright':358 'corner':223 'credibl':31,113 'date':193 'deck':34,68,116,239,321 'decor':71,221,299 'deep':7,45 'deliver':38,120 'demo':102,252 'densiti':98 'design':207,276,290 'differ':310 'dimens':199 'doesn':287 'drop':265 'duplic':242,254 'element':222 'emit':334 'example.html':169,375 'exist':198,256 'fast':153 'feel':27,109,151 'file':178 'font':211,297 'formal':96 'full':350 'geometr':227 'github.com':347 'github.com/zarazhangrui/beautiful-html-templates/tree/main/templates/signal).':346 'glanc':93 'gold':18,56,159 'grain':226 'grammar':305 'grid':218 'handler':328 'headlin':188 'high':97,99 'hold':253 'hot':152 'html':2,67 'html-ppt-zhangzara-sign':1 'ident':236 'illustr':229 'imag':202 'includ':355 'inlin':326 'insid':88 'institut':20,32,58,114 'intact':331 'intent':155 'investor':33,115 'keep':313 'keyboard':327 'label':196,274 'layout':81,217,243,262,278,284 'leav':329 'legal':39,121 'length':240 'less':264 'licens':338,344,353,365 'loud':145 'match':197 'metadata':387 'miss':277 'mit':343,352 'mit-licens':342 'mix':80,95 'must':368 'mute':17,55 'muted-gold':16,54 'name':192 'navi':8,46,158 'navig':315 'need':282 'never':209,306 'notic':359 'number':191,273 'one':90 'origin':357 'output':332 'page':272 'page-numb':271 'palett':70,214,298 'paper':12,50,225 'part':233 'pitc':43 'pitch':125 'placehold':181,203 'play':156 'polici':40,122 'ppt':3 'present':36,118 'preserv':205 'quiet':22,60,141 'rather':143 'read':139 'real':187 'recolor':212 'redistribut':370 'replac':180 'research':132 'restraint':160 'restructur':215 'rhythm':302 'runtim':316,381 'scheme':94 'scratch':293 'section':195 'see':382 'self':65 'self-contain':64 'shape':228 'ship':318,322,360 'signal':5,6,44 'singl':15,53,63 'skill':363 'skill-html-ppt-zhangzara-signal' 'slide':74,100,257,266,281 'snapshot':388 'sober':164 'sourc':337 'source-nexu-io' 'space':301 'stay':87 'strip':220 'strong':128 'substitut':210 'svgs':230 'swap':201 'system':72,86,208 'tag':336 'tech':131 'templat':83,286,311 'template.json':376,383 'text':354 'togeth':79 'topic-agent-skills' 'topic-ai-agents' 'topic-ai-design' 'topic-byok' 'topic-claude' 'topic-claude-code-for-design' 'topic-claude-design' 'topic-coding-agents' 'topic-design-systems' 'topic-design-tools' 'topic-desktop-app' 'topic-figma-alternative' 'tune':78 'typographi':69 'updat':270 'upstream':341,351,386 'use':294 'user':172,185,246 'vendor':339,379 'vocabulari':75,300 'voic':165 'want':137 'weight':23,61 'weighti':28,110 'work':135,177 'workflow':166 'workspac':174 'zarazhangrui/beautiful-html-templates':345 'zhangzara':4","prices":[{"id":"ef451e28-f189-4771-87b3-266d97aee4c6","listingId":"417b8136-2d10-45b6-b013-7fab759d9dd4","amountUsd":"0","unit":"free","nativeCurrency":null,"nativeAmount":null,"chain":null,"payTo":null,"paymentMethod":"skill-free","isPrimary":true,"details":{"org":"nexu-io","category":"open-design","install_from":"skills.sh"},"createdAt":"2026-05-08T06:51:50.594Z"}],"sources":[{"listingId":"417b8136-2d10-45b6-b013-7fab759d9dd4","source":"github","sourceId":"nexu-io/open-design/html-ppt-zhangzara-signal","sourceUrl":"https://github.com/nexu-io/open-design/tree/main/skills/html-ppt-zhangzara-signal","isPrimary":false,"firstSeenAt":"2026-05-08T06:51:50.594Z","lastSeenAt":"2026-05-11T06:52:23.943Z"}],"details":{"listingId":"417b8136-2d10-45b6-b013-7fab759d9dd4","quickStartSnippet":null,"exampleRequest":null,"exampleResponse":null,"schema":null,"openapiUrl":null,"agentsTxtUrl":null,"citations":[],"useCases":[],"bestFor":[],"notFor":[],"kindDetails":{"org":"nexu-io","slug":"html-ppt-zhangzara-signal","github":{"repo":"nexu-io/open-design","stars":36607,"topics":["agent-skills","ai-agents","ai-design","byok","claude","claude-code-for-design","claude-design","coding-agents","design-systems","design-tools","desktop-app","figma-alternative","generative-ai","hermes-agent","local-first","nextjs","no-code","prototyping","ui-generator","vibe-coding"],"license":"apache-2.0","html_url":"https://github.com/nexu-io/open-design","pushed_at":"2026-05-11T06:48:43Z","description":"🎨 Local-first, open-source alternative to Anthropic's Claude Design. ⚡ 19 Skills · ✨ 71 brand-grade Design Systems 🖼 Generate web · desktop · mobile prototypes · slides · images · videos · HyperFrames 📦 Sandboxed preview · HTML/PDF/PPTX/MP4 export 🤖 Runs on Claude Code / Codex / Cursor / Gemini / OpenCode / Qwen / Copilot / Hermes / Kimi CLI.","skill_md_sha":"bd024b0d0a5e8aef2f43cee808cad7e5841cecf9","skill_md_path":"skills/html-ppt-zhangzara-signal/SKILL.md","default_branch":"main","skill_tree_url":"https://github.com/nexu-io/open-design/tree/main/skills/html-ppt-zhangzara-signal"},"layout":"multi","source":"github","category":"open-design","frontmatter":{"name":"html-ppt-zhangzara-signal","description":"Signal — Deep navy canvas with bone paper and a single muted-gold accent; institutional with quiet weight. Anything that should feel weighty, considered, and credibly institutional: investor decks, board presentations, consulting deliverables, legal / policy briefs, advisory pitches."},"skills_sh_url":"https://skills.sh/nexu-io/open-design/html-ppt-zhangzara-signal"},"updatedAt":"2026-05-11T06:52:23.943Z"}}